Home / Function/ FullBinaryMemcacheRequest() — netty Function Reference

FullBinaryMemcacheRequest() — netty Function Reference

Architecture documentation for the FullBinaryMemcacheRequest() function in BinaryMemcacheObjectAggregator.java from the netty codebase.

Entity Profile

Dependency Diagram

graph TD
  0f0746ac_8da2_2143_7b3c_97e0738a4b2f["FullBinaryMemcacheRequest()"]
  71b48cdd_3474_4f0b_6eb9_4f124c3da71a["BinaryMemcacheObjectAggregator"]
  0f0746ac_8da2_2143_7b3c_97e0738a4b2f -->|defined in| 71b48cdd_3474_4f0b_6eb9_4f124c3da71a
  style 0f0746ac_8da2_2143_7b3c_97e0738a4b2f f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

codec-memcache/src/main/java/io/netty/handler/codec/memcache/binary/BinaryMemcacheObjectAggregator.java lines 59–76

    private static FullBinaryMemcacheRequest toFullRequest(BinaryMemcacheRequest request, ByteBuf content) {
        ByteBuf key = request.key() == null ? null : request.key().retain();
        ByteBuf extras = request.extras() == null ? null : request.extras().retain();
        DefaultFullBinaryMemcacheRequest fullRequest =
                new DefaultFullBinaryMemcacheRequest(key, extras, content);

        fullRequest.setMagic(request.magic());
        fullRequest.setOpcode(request.opcode());
        fullRequest.setKeyLength(request.keyLength());
        fullRequest.setExtrasLength(request.extrasLength());
        fullRequest.setDataType(request.dataType());
        fullRequest.setTotalBodyLength(request.totalBodyLength());
        fullRequest.setOpaque(request.opaque());
        fullRequest.setCas(request.cas());
        fullRequest.setReserved(request.reserved());

        return fullRequest;
    }

Domain

Subdomains

Frequently Asked Questions

What does FullBinaryMemcacheRequest() do?
FullBinaryMemcacheRequest() is a function in the netty codebase, defined in codec-memcache/src/main/java/io/netty/handler/codec/memcache/binary/BinaryMemcacheObjectAggregator.java.
Where is FullBinaryMemcacheRequest() defined?
FullBinaryMemcacheRequest() is defined in codec-memcache/src/main/java/io/netty/handler/codec/memcache/binary/BinaryMemcacheObjectAggregator.java at line 59.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free